If there’s been any doubt about India being the next major target market for tech businesses, Kleiner Perkins partner Mary Meeker’s latest Internet Trends Report should make that clear as day. The report, which spans 355 pages, dedicates 55 pages solely to the state of internet and mobile access in India. The first major takeaway is that the country now has 355 million internet users, which amounts to roughly 27 percent of the population of 1.3 billion people. That’s up from 277 million in 2015.
